I'm a sucker for costumed superheroes, no two ways about it- and, if said costumed superhero, in the course of his/her adventures, makes a valid point about Life in general (or Life in these Trying Times in particular), so much the better. The irony of CASSHAN is that the Earth's environment is being protected by machines forged in the likeness of Man. (Many experts, these days, are laying the blame for Global Warming on nothing less than The Industrial Revolution itself.) The Protector of Earth is a Proxy- an Artificial Being. A Mandroid. That this mini-series is so beautifully rendered helps, as well. CASSHAN pulls no punches (it's up to the viewer to decide for themselves- up to a given point- who's really the hero and who the villain), and is told well enough to keep one engrossed from beginning to end. Can't ask for more than that. Highly recommended.
